Output 53389ca00e04c635fdd7330fcd9d9e8a0501a90b6d16f2cd825d57def52cc01c:45

value
1557656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 128c3e24ba8359a9df714f593f831faebaf8a1be OP_EQUAL
address
D6qAhwxUSiW1iSNGQtvLqQ4tqQZHxAAqMU
transaction
53389ca00e04c635fdd7330fcd9d9e8a0501a90b6d16f2cd825d57def52cc01c
spent
true